The Aldrete rating is comparatively easy and can readily be obtained by the attending nurse in the restoration area. Yet, these knowledge are not solid enough to demonstrate the superiority of any one of these methods over the others, but rather imply that solely a number of strategies have the potential to make sure protected affected person discharge. Most of the evidence highlights that the Aldrete and PADSS scoring systems are maybe essentially the most promising ones, resulting in a major improvement in secure discharge compared to ordinary care. Alternatively, in some facilities the Aldrete score is utilized to evaluate early restoration and is accompanied by mPADSS for a extra thorough assessment .
